Motivated by the untamed elegance of forests, these gardens were when considered emblems of wealth and standing. Woodland landscapes continue to be a favored option among property owners seeking to create a tranquil and all-natural place in their backyard. One specifying aspect of these landscapes is the unification of native plants, which have successfully adjusted to the neighborhood environment and soil conditions.




By accepting native plants, woodland gardens demand much less water, plant food, and chemicals, making them a more sustainable and environmentally-friendly option. Formal yards are commonly connected with grand estates and palaces, where whatever is perfectly in proportion and in line. These yards adhere to a strict geometric pattern, with straight lines and best angles dominating the layout.


Making use of hardscaping components such as fountains, sculptures, and pathways is additionally typical in official gardens. On the various other hand, informal yards have an even more relaxed and natural feel to them. They are not bound by rigorous guidelines or geometric patterns, permitting an extra natural format. Informal gardens have a tendency to have bent paths, irregularly shaped flower beds, and a mix of different plant types.

You can create an aesthetically pleasing landscape by adhering to these 6 concepts of design. There are 6 concepts of style that have actually been used by artists for centuries throughout all art kinds, paint and flower design along with landscape layout. They are: Equilibrium Focalization Simpleness Rhythm and Line Proportion Unity Equilibrium is a state of being along with seeing.


There are 2 significant sorts of equilibrium: balanced and unbalanced. Balanced balance is used in official landscapes when one side of the landscape is a mirror photo of the contrary side. These landscapes usually make use of geometric patterns in the sidewalks, growing beds and also exactly how the plants are trimmed right into shapes.

Any kind of excellent design has a focal point the location where the customer's eye is first attracted. Focalization is often referred to as focalization of interest or simply centerpiece. The centerpiece is the strongest component in the style in any kind of given sight. A home's focal factor is frequently the front door.
